Обязанности
- Развитие системы сбора и подготовки данных (импорты, предварительные расчеты данных).
- Имплементация ETL, Data пайплайнов.
- Проектировать и реализовывать REST API для внутреннего и внешнего использования.
- Развитие API к данным (для таблиц, графиков).
- Проектирование витрин данных и кубов.
- Оптимизация производительности системы, обнаружение узких мест.
- Подготовка unit тестов (pytest).
- Подготовка технической документации (confluence).
- Участие в командных Scrum-мероприятиях.
Требования
- Общий опыт коммерческой разработки от 3-х лет.
- Отличные знания Python 3.
- Опыт работы с Django, DRF, Aiohttp, celery.
- Опыт работы с Docker.
- Опыт работы с PostgreSQL, Clickhouse.
- Опыт создания REST API.
- Пользователь Linux на уровне продвинутого пользователя.
- Навыки в рефакторинге и оптимизации кода, декомпозиции задач. ∙ Умение и желание писать и поддерживать тесты.
- Опыт проектирования бд - большой плюс
- Опыт работы с планировщиками/оркестарторами (Prefect, Apache Airflow, Luigi, etc) ∙ опыт работы с apache kafka - большой плюс
Мы предлагаем
- Перспективы профессионального и карьерного роста;
- Молодой и дружный коллектив, постоянное обучение по продуктам компании; ∙ Стабильная заработная плата;
- Официальное трудоустройство по ТК РФ;
- График работы 5/2 с 9 до 18 или с 10 до 19, возможна удаленная работа по согласованию с руководителем.